In natural numbers 20 ~ 30, even numbers have (); odd numbers have (); prime numbers have (); and sum numbers have ()
In natural numbers 20 ~ 30, even numbers have (20,22,24,26,28,30); odd numbers have (21,23,25,27,29); prime numbers have (23,29); sum numbers have (20,21,22,24,25,26,27,28,30)
Given that a is prime, B is odd, and a ^ 2 + B = 2001, find the value of a + B
Please state the process
Since 2001 and B are odd numbers, a ^ 2 must be even, then a is even, but a is prime, and the only even prime is 2
a=2
Then the known equation becomes:
4+b=2001
b=1997
So:
a+b
=2+1997
=1999
Product of multiplication of two prime numbers ()
A. It must be prime B. it must be odd C. It must be even D. It must be composite
In addition to 1 and itself, the factor of the product of two prime numbers also has these two factors. According to the meaning of composite number, the product of two prime numbers must be composite number
The product of two continuous natural numbers must be (). 1 prime number 2 composite number 3 odd number 4 even number
Even number
Because two consecutive natural numbers must have an even number and an odd number
Then the product must be even
